UKODTRN at UK Kidney Week 2022 (06/2022)

We were delighted to be invited to UK Kidney Week 2022 to present a transplantation session on the UKODTRN and some of its activity.

This was held in early June 2022 in Birmingham and some of the Executive Team were thrilled to be profiling our activities during the last 2+ years during the pandemic.  There was extra excitement as it was the first time we had met in person since the Network’s inception!

The 90 minute session was chaired by Dr Joyce Popoola from St George’s (sadly Dr Sian Griffin, an Exec member, who would have co-chaired,  was down with Covid). The session started with Professor Lorna Marson presenting the Network’s ‘UK Transplant Lifelines Project: personalised immunosuppression in solid organ transplantation’. This was followed by Professor Tony Dorling whose subject was ‘Defining novel metrics of success in transplantation’. This was followed by Karen Rockell and Neerja Jain who presented on ‘Diverse Patient & Public Involvement & Engagement’. The formal presentations concluded with an abstract by Mr Callum Arthurs on  Automated kidney zone and structure identification in renal transplant biopsies. The 90-minute session ended with a lively and interesting panel discussion, questions and informal conversations with attendees.
